Paula Bemis
Licensed Psychotherapist - LCSW/LICSW -
I believe strongly in creating a place of safety where my clients can feel seen, heard, and understood. I enjoy helping people navigate life’s journey. I am passionate about helping clients heal, align with their authentic self, and face life with compassion and self-appreciation. I am a therapist who is direct and goal-oriented. My ultimate goal is for my clients to know and feel they are worthy of love. My therapeutic style is eclectic, driven by the client’s beliefs and where they are at currently. My approach to therapy is trauma-informed, strength-based, and collaborative. I am a certified EMDR therapist and often incorporate EMDR ( Eye Movement, Desensitization, and Reprocessing) with clients.
I am licensed in Alaska, Minnesota, and Wyoming.
